Hey Kevin,
Although our team did terrible, we had a great time. I thought you all did a real fine job and if it were a different date, we would compete again in a second. I do think part of the appeal was its location and ties to the festival. Have you thought about where you plan on hosting the new contest? This could very well impact public attendance, which may in turn impact your sponsorships, vendor booth sales and the kinds of income generating revenues that will help raise much needed cash - which you will need if it is to be a stand alone contest. Not saying you are, but you should not rely solely on application fees to run it. Be careful with overhead - like insurance, security, waste management, outhouses, wash stations, electric, permitting fees, etc. These things are gonna cut into your income and unless you have an alternative source to application fees, it could make or break it. As a stand alone contest - we've run a pretty successful event. We started as a small block party and have grown steady both qualitatively and quantitatively each year. Location is a major component to our success. Also having a dedicated, reliable committee is key. Slow and steady wins the race here. I am more than willing to talk with you and help.
